Changelog — Quarterly key rotation for the Fernvale transcoding farm. All worker nodes now verify encoder plugins against the new signing key; the old key was retired after the v12.4 batch completed. No transcoding jobs were interrupted, and throughput held steady during the cutover. Pipelines that cache verification material should refresh before Friday. For the sync notes, the active signing key is recorded below.

rollout seal: bky9_PeXH1fTLY

**Finance Review Summary — Project Lanternfold Delay**

Project Lanternfold, the internal scheduling system rebuild, is now nine weeks behind plan. Overruns total roughly 240,000, driven by contractor turnover and scope additions. Branch rollout is deferred to Q3; interim workarounds remain in place. Further spend is frozen pending a revised estimate. The reason this delay matters strategically is noted below.

internal memo for hafog-hadug: The pricing group signed off on a budget of $16.1 million for Project Gorir. The renewal with Oliionax Systems closes at $14.1 million a year, 46 percent above the last contract.

# Spoolhaus printer-spooler microservice — plugin-facing constants.
# Plugin authors: your render hooks run inside the spool loop, so the
# budgets defined here are hard limits, not suggestions. Exceeding the
# per-job render timeout marks the job failed and your plugin gets
# rate-limited for the session. Queue depths and backoff intervals are
# also enforced server-side; mirror them in your client to avoid
# rejected submissions. The enforced values appear immediately below.

tuning table, fawip-fahag:
WEIGHTS = {
    "novwyn": 452,
    "casdor": 675,
}

**Audit item 14 — Address autocomplete widget (Quickfill)**

Heads up: check that Quickfill debounces keystrokes properly and doesn't fire a lookup on every character. We got burned last quarter when the Tollridge rollout hammered the suggestion service. Also verify the dropdown is keyboard-navigable and that stale responses get discarded when a newer query lands first. If any of this looks off, don't just patch it quietly — log it in the audit sheet. Questions about this item go to the current owner, named below.

named custodian: Quenael Briax